I've just started to use PowerPoint and I'm hoping you can help me out with
a few basic questions on Animations:
1. I am able to create animations, however PowerPoint unilaterally assigns
names to my objects; for example: Group 6, Object 9, etc. Is there any way
that I can name my objects explicitly? This will help out immensely when
modifying animations, since right now I don't have a way to look at the
animation list and see which animation belongs to which object, or group of
objects.
2. Is there any way to retain an animation if its associated object is
modified? For example, let's say I have a picture which flies out. If I
decide to change the picture, what's happening is the old object is removed
and the new picture is inserted as a brand new object. Naturally, I need to
recreate the animation. Is there any way around this?
3. Same question applies to a group. If I ungroup to make modification and
then regroup, the new group is a new group object. The old group is gone
along with its animation, and I need to recreate the animation for the new
group.
4. Is there any way to do a fade out on entrance? A fade in starts from
nothing and fades in to show the object. A fade out would start with the
object and disolve to nothing. I don't see this effect offered.
